Popular secondary school’s expansion plans
St Mary Magdalene Academy’s proposals come as Islington schools are seeing a drop in pupil numbers
Friday, 12th May 2023 — By Anna Lamche

St Mary Magdalene Academy
A SECONDARY school is planning to expand its student places.
Oversubscribed St Mary Magdalene Academy in Liverpool Road currently has 1,542 students enrolled, despite its formal capacity standing at just 1,360 pupils.
Run by Hive Education Trust, the school is now looking to formally expand its capacity to 1,590 students.
According to the school’s website, the new students will be accommodated at “our new site at Amwell Street”.
The consultation period will run until Wednesday May 24, with an in-person event at the school planned for May 19.
This expansion comes at a time when Islington schools are seeing a drop in pupil numbers.
According to the Town Hall’s School Organisation Plan, over the next five years schools across the borough will see “just above” 10 per cent of their places unfilled.
